// Conversion math in Tillbridge must round half-even, always.
// We lost 0.3% on Oskari-to-credit conversions last quarter
// because two services rounded differently and drift compounded.
// This constant pins the rounding mode; do not change it
// without sign-off from the payments group in Velmora.
// Regression verified against the fixture suite; the
// validating build is referenced by the token below.

build token for kahop-kagep: htk6_72fc45

Ticket: Staging env misconfigured for Siftgate bloom filter

The bloom layer in front of the Pellet KV store is rejecting all lookups in staging because the env file was copied from the dev template without credentials. False-positive tuning values are fine; only the auth line is missing. To unblock the weekly demo, the Pellet admission secret must be set on the following line.

env line for yaguf-fajop: LEDGER_TOKEN13=fb08984397349

**CI note: gateway rate limits biting again**

Heads up for the sync — the Brindlegate internal gateway started throttling our integration suite Tuesday. Turns out the Copperfin test runner retries aggressively and blew past the per-team quota. We've added jitter and backoff, and asked the gateway folks to bump our bucket. Builds should be green again, but flag anything weird. The trace token from the failing run is below for reference.

session token of kageg-tahop = htk14_af3c1ccccb7dcf

CI note: cold-start timeouts on Fennick handlers

For the eng sync: the canary stage keeps timing out because our serverless handlers cold-start over the four-second probe limit after the dependency bump. Warm invocations are fine. Mitigation in place: the pipeline now sends one priming request before probes run. Longer term we should trim the import graph. Baseline timings were captured against the build listed below.

pipeline stamp: htk31_f769b577b3028a4e9958e5bb8d1259a

Subject: Quickstore 4.2 — bloom filter now fronts the KV layer

Plugin authors: starting with this release, Quickstore places a bloom filter ahead of the key-value store. Negative lookups return faster; false positives fall through safely. No API changes are required on your side. Verify your plugin against the staging build referenced below.

session token of fahif-tadup = htk3_9c7